Albert Frey’s former Tramway Gas Station is a quick architecture stop with maps and handy orientation. Pair it with the tram, not a separate drive.

Palm Springs’ most natural evening walk, especially on Thursday when VillageFest closes Palm Canyon Drive to traffic. Check the current schedule and road closure before you go.

Palm and Andreas canyons are the serious nature counterweight to downtown. Start early, bring water, and do not treat summer midday as a test of character.
